3D Printing and Its Impact on Construction Technology

One of the most significant advancements in the field of construction technology is 3D printing. 3D printing has revolutionized the way we manufacture products, and it has enormous potential in the construction industry. With 3D printing, it is now possible to print entire buildings, which has several advantages over traditional construction methods.

One of the significant benefits of 3D printing in construction technology is speed. 3D printing can significantly reduce the time it takes to construct a building. Additionally, 3D printing allows for greater precision, which can lead to fewer mistakes and a better-quality final product.

Another advantage of 3D printing in construction technology is cost-effectiveness. Traditional construction methods can be expensive, and 3D printing has the potential to reduce costs significantly. This is because 3D printing requires less labor and materials than traditional construction methods.

Robotics in Construction Technology Examples

Another futuristic technology that is transforming the construction industry is robotics. Robotics has been used in manufacturing for a long time, but it is now making its way into the construction industry. Robots can perform tasks that are dangerous or impossible for humans to do, making construction sites safer and more efficient.

One example of robotics in construction technology is the use of drones. Drones can be used to survey construction sites, monitor progress, and even transport materials. This can save time and money, as well as make construction sites safer by reducing the need for workers to perform risky tasks.

Another example of robotics in construction technology is the use of autonomous vehicles. Autonomous vehicles can transport materials and equipment to and from construction sites, reducing the need for human drivers. This can save time, reduce costs, and make construction sites safer by reducing the risk of accidents.

Internet of Things (IoT) and Its Role in New Construction Technology

The Internet of Things (IoT) is another futuristic technology that is transforming the construction industry. The IoT refers to the interconnectedness of devices and objects through the internet. In the construction industry, the IoT can be used to monitor and control various aspects of a construction site.

For example, sensors can be placed in concrete to monitor its strength and durability. This can help construction companies ensure that their buildings are safe and meet regulatory standards. The IoT can also be used to monitor the health and safety of workers on construction sites, reducing the risk of accidents and injuries.

Another way the IoT is being used in new construction technology is through the use of smart buildings. Smart buildings are buildings that use sensors and other technologies to monitor and control various aspects of the building, such as lighting, temperature, and security. This can lead to significant energy savings and a better overall building experience for occupants.

Augmented Reality (AR) and Virtual Reality (VR) in Construction Technology

Augmented reality (AR) and virtual reality (VR) are two futuristic technologies that have enormous potential in the construction industry. AR and VR can be used to create virtual models of construction projects, allowing architects, engineers, and contractors to visualize and test designs before construction begins.

AR and VR can also be used to train workers on construction sites. For example, workers can use AR and VR to learn how to operate heavy machinery or perform complex tasks safely. This can reduce the risk of accidents and injuries and improve the overall efficiency of construction sites.

Self-Healing Concrete and Other Innovative Construction Materials

Self-healing concrete is a futuristic technology that could revolutionize the construction industry. Self-healing concrete contains bacteria that can repair cracks and other damage automatically. This can extend the lifespan of buildings and reduce the need for costly repairs.

Other innovative construction materials that are being developed include self-cleaning glass and energy-generating pavement. Self-cleaning glass uses nanotechnology to repel dirt and water, reducing the need for cleaning. Energy-generating pavement uses solar panels to generate electricity, which can be used to power streetlights and other infrastructure.

Green Technology Trends in Construction

Green technology is a growing trend in the construction industry. Green technology refers to technologies that are environmentally friendly and sustainable. Green technology can be used to reduce the environmental impact of construction projects and make buildings more energy-efficient.

One example of green technology in construction is the use of green roofs. Green roofs are covered in vegetation and can help to reduce the amount of energy required to heat and cool buildings. Green roofs can also help to improve air quality and reduce stormwater runoff.

Another example of green technology in construction is the use of renewable energy sources. Solar panels and wind turbines are two examples of renewable energy sources that can be used to power buildings. This can reduce the amount of energy required from traditional sources, such as fossil fuels.
